What does the exhaust color look like and feel like?

Could be clogged exhaust, REV engine and feel exhaust flow out the tail pipe, if pressure flattens out as RPMs are still going up you have a restriction.
Vacuum gauge is $25 and a very helpful tool for diagnosing power issues, including clogged exhaust.

If exhaust is grayish you are running too rich, if engine pings after warm up you are running too lean.
Is Choke Plate opening all the way after warm up?

If exhaust is whitish color you are burning coolant
